Take 1 part grandma's basement, 1 part toy store, 1 part random rummage sale you've stumbled upon, and 1 part elementary school teacher supply store and you've got The Dollar Scholar. There's crip-crap, tchotchkes, old books, used lamps, stickers, stuffed animals, things you'd find in my dad's garage, and a lot of fun to be had by all who visit.
Employee (owner?) who greeted us was super friendly at first and then let us do our wandering thing, which was awesome.
In a word: neat-o.
